Khafre
Most scholars date the Great Sphinx to the 4th dynasty and affix ownership to Khafre. However, some believe that it was built by Khafre’s older brother Redjedef (Djedefre) to commemorate their father, Khufu, whose pyramid at Giza is known as the Great Pyramid.

Ancient Egyptians, like modern Egyptians, loved children, and took good care of them. Mothers nursed their babies for three or four years. Little ones were carried by their mothers in a soft sling, so that they felt her body’s warmth and her presence always. … Infants were probably held most of the time.
How did Local governors help the pharaoh to rule all of Egypt? they made sure the flood waters were shared fairly among farmers through the use of canals and storage pools. Some of them were in charge of collecting taxes in their areas. They also severed as local judges.
